Outreach Hub and Baby Clothes Swaps

In 2022 we pivoted from our media projects to providing an Outreach Hub where we distributed donations of furniture, clothing, food and baby supplies for families impacted by the floods throughout this region.  Since 2023 we have provided a FREE drop in centre and clothes swap to all families with babies and toddlers.  This wonderful service has had so much support from the community that the donations we've received have spawned three more free clothes swaps!  Lennox Head, Evans Head and Lismore.

How do the baby clothes swaps work?
​
Our baby and toddler clothes are fully stocked from the clothing donated by the community.  So, you can exchange your clean, good quality baby and toddler clothes (up to size 5) for the next size up, change the baby's nappy, have a cuppa and chat with our volunteer facilitators and meet other mums, dads and carers.  All clothing is given for free and you don't need to bring donations to take any of our baby clothes.  We have so much to give away!

We staffed by volunteers from the community and we generally have some support from the venues we operate from so that our rent is reduced.  If you would like to make a cash donation to cover rent, we would gratefully accept!  We generally have a donation jar at each clothes swap or you can make an online donation here.

NOTE: We can't accept baby furniture or equipment (prams, cots, highchairs, etc) due to lack of storage.  Please only bring your donations when we are open.  Do not leave donations outside.
